How much do aviation sales remote j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average yearly pay for aviation sales remote in the United States is $81,617.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,000.00 and $96,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an aviation sales remote?

An Aviation Sales Remote job involves selling aircraft, aviation parts, or related services from a location outside of a traditional office, often working from home or another remote setting. Professionals in this role connect with clients, negotiate deals, and manage customer relationships using digital tools, phone calls, and virtual meetings. This position requires a strong understanding of the aviation industry, excellent communication skills, and the ability to work independently while meeting sales targets.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an aviation sales remote professional?

To thrive as an Aviation Sales Remote professional, you need in-depth knowledge of aviation products and services, strong sales acumen, and often a background in business or aviation studies. Familiarity with CRM software, virtual meeting platforms, and aviation industry databases is typically required. Outstanding communication, negotiation, and self-motivation are crucial soft skills for building client relationships and achieving sales targets from a remote environment. These competencies are vital for effectively reaching clients, closing deals, and driving business growth in a competitive, global aviation market.

How does working remotely in aviation sales impact collaboration with internal teams and clients?

Remote aviation sales professionals often collaborate closely with internal teams such as operations, customer support, and marketing using digital communication tools. While not physically present, maintaining regular virtual meetings and clear communication is essential to coordinate efforts, share client insights, and address customer needs efficiently. You will also leverage CRM platforms to track leads and ensure seamless handoffs between departments. Building strong relationships remotely requires proactive outreach and responsiveness to clients and colleagues alike, but it can lead to a flexible and productive work environment if managed well.

What is the difference between Aviation Sales Remote vs Aviation Account Manager?

AspectAviation Sales RemoteAviation Account Manager
CredentialsSales experience, industry knowledge, sometimes certificationsSales experience, customer relationship skills, industry knowledge
Work EnvironmentRemote, home-based, often independentOffice or client-site, collaborative environment
Employer & Industry UsageAirlines, aerospace companies, brokersAirlines, aerospace firms, parts suppliers
Search & Comparison IntentRemote sales roles in aviationManaging client accounts in aviation

While both roles involve sales in the aviation industry, Aviation Sales Remote focuses on prospecting and closing deals remotely, often independently. In contrast, an Aviation Account Manager emphasizes maintaining and growing existing client relationships, often in a more collaborative or office-based setting. Both roles require industry knowledge and sales skills but differ mainly in work environment and primary responsibilities.

Regional Sales Manager - Helicopters (Remote within US)

This position can be worked Remotely within US with travel to the offices and customer sites as required (Travel 30-50% approx.)

Build an Aviation Career You're Proud Of

At StandardAero, we use our ingenuity and expertise to solve aviation's most complex challenges. With over a century of aerospace excellence, we provide engine and airframe maintenance, repair, and overhaul solutions our which keep out customers flying safely and efficiently worldwide.

As a Regional Sales Manager supporting our Helicopter business, you'll play a key role in driving growth, strengthening customer relationships, and delivering innovative MRO solutions across the Central and Southern U.S. region. This is an opportunity to join a collaborative, customer-focused team within a stable and growing global aerospace organization.

If you thrive in a relationship-driven aviation environment and enjoy identifying opportunities, solving customer challenges, and delivering results, we'd love to hear from you!


What You'll Do

  • Manage and grow helicopter MRO customer accounts across the Central/South U.S. region 
  • Develop and execute regional sales strategies to support revenue growth and market expansion 
  • Build long-term customer relationships while identifying new business opportunities 
  • Conduct customer meetings, presentations, contract discussions, and commercial negotiations 
  • Partner cross-functionally with Operations, Engineering, Supply Chain, Finance, and Customer Service teams to support customer success 
  • Coordinate sales activities with Business Development and divisional leadership teams 
  • Maintain accurate pipeline activity, forecasting, and customer account information within Salesforce CRM 
  • Represent StandardAero at trade shows, industry events, customer visits, and business meetings 
  • Support continuous improvement initiatives and strategic growth opportunities 
  • Ensure compliance with company quality, safety, environmental, and regulatory requirements 

Minimum Qualifications

  • 5+ years of experience in aviation MRO sales, account management, business development, or related aerospace commercial roles 
  • Experience supporting helicopter, engine, or airframe MRO programs and customer accounts 
  • Knowledge of aviation MRO operations, customer requirements, and market dynamics 
  • Experience collaborating cross-functionally with operational and commercial teams to support customer solutions and business growth 
  • Ability to travel up to 50% 
  • Valid passport required 

Preferred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Business, Engineering, Aviation Management, or a related field; or equivalent experience
  • Helicopter MRO sales experience 
  • Experience supporting operators within the Central/South U.S. region 
  • Technical aviation background, including A&P certification or related training 
  • Experience supporting turbine engine and/or rotorcraft platforms 
  • Strong relationship-building, negotiation, and presentation skills
